Remove the Webkit thread in the PPAPI plugin process and perform the text and font operations
on the PPAPI main thread. This thread is now registered as the Webkit thread.
Fixes performance issues seen in Flapper with text and font operations. It appears that the perf
issues occur due to context switching between the main thread and the webkit thread.
As per comments from Brett moving the font forwarding code inline to ppb_font_shared.cc. This file
has been moved to ppapi/shared_impl/private as it now brings in a dependency on WebKit. The font
creation has been wired up to the ResourceCreationAPI as suggested.

When running the generator with default arguments from a CWD other than
the script's directory, the default arguments will be incorrect. This adds
a check which will print an error message and fail. If any argument,
including the default arguments are provided on the command-line, then this
check is bypassed.
